The Weight of External Validation:



We often seek validation from others to feel worthy, accepted, and loved. But this need for external approval can:



1. Stifle our authenticity: We may hide our true selves to fit in or avoid rejection.

2. Create anxiety and stress: Constantly seeking validation can lead to feelings of inadequacy and self-doubt.

3. Limit our potential: By prioritizing others' opinions, we may miss out on opportunities and experiences that could help us grow.



Embracing the Freedom of Indifference:



So, what happens when you reach a level of freedom where you don't care what anyone thinks?



1. Authenticity shines through: You're unapologetically yourself, without pretenses or apologies.

2. Confidence soars: You're no longer held back by the fear of others' opinions.

3. Creativity and innovation thrive: Without the constraints of external validation, you're free to explore and express yourself.
